What makes a kick butt character? Let me tell you. 🙂

First off, they don’t do nothing BUT kicking butt. They are well rounded as a character. They know how to love, to care, to sympathize, to empathize and to wield a weapon to survive. They have their wits about them in stressful situations and when possible, get out of tricky situations using strategic thinking instead of their hands, legs or other physical element.

And for that reason, I pick Birdie from Crux by Julie Reece as MY kick butt character.

Crux by Julie Reece
Crux by Julie Reece

She should have run. Now, she’ll have to fight.Eighteen year old Birdie may be homeless, but she’s surviving, that is until a mysterious guy throws money in the air like a crazy game show host and she grabs some with the idea she’ll be able to buy dinner that night.

In that singular moment, unassuming Birdie becomes the girl in everyone’s viewfinder. Thugs want to kill her. Money-guy wants to recruit her. The very hot, very rich and very out of her league Grey Mathews wants to save her.

Birdie, though, wants nothing to do with any of them until she realizes fate didn’t bring them all together.

Her heritage did.

Now, with only twenty-one days left, she’s got to decide whether to follow in the footsteps of those before her or risk her life for people she’s only just met.
